Fewer Masks — More Freedom

Eckhart Tolle once said, “You will only be free when you realize who you are.”


I call this the journey back to myself.


A key part of this journey is recognizing who I am not — letting go of the roles and masks that no longer serve me, and the expectations placed on me by others and myself. This process takes honesty and courage, because sometimes we have to face parts of ourselves we’d rather ignore.


When Michelangelo was asked how he created his sculptures, he said, “I take a stone and remove everything that is not the sculpture.”


That simple yet profound thought beautifully captures the essence of self-discovery: to uncover our true nature, we must chip away the excess — the roles, labels, and expectations that don’t belong to us.


So this path is not just about finding yourself — it’s about liberation.Whoever dares to take this journey gains the freedom to express their true self.And to me, that is the highest form of freedom.
